
As its name suggests, the 1159ci HD XD Combo is another fish finder equipped with Xtreme Depth technology, with a depth capability up to 3,000 ft., and a power output of 1,000 Watts (RMS) / 8,000 Watts (PTP). It’s one of the best Humminbird fish finders without Side Imaging and Down Imaging to have, the lack of these two sonar technologies cut off over $500 from the price.
This unit has Dual Beam Plus sonar with SwitchFire, its sonar including 3 operational modes: 200 kHz with a narrow, and more accurate, 20° view, 83 kHz, with a wider view of 60°, and the XD view, with a frequency of 50 kHz and a 74° view. Although it does not have SI, DI nor does it support 360 Imaging, this unit can however be upgraded with a Quadra Beam Plus sonar, for a more diversified view.
Its standard transducer is a Gimbal XNT 9 DB 74 T.
Similar to the other units of the 1100 series, the 1159ci HD XD Combo has a 10.4-inch diagonal display, 800H x 600V pixel resolution, full color (65,000 color grayscale), with LED backlight technology.
Its navigational capabilities include precision GPS, GPS speed and the ContourXD cartography pack, which covers over 3,000 U.S. lake maps. It can store up to 2,750 waypoints, 45 routes and 50 tracks (20,000 points each). It also supports Navionics Platinum+ , Gold & HotMaps, and Lakemaster, having 2 SD card slots.
The Humminbird 1159ci HD XD Combo is a unit with Ethernet. However, features such as Radar2, NMEA2000 are only optional. Like most 2014 new models, it does not support WeatherSense.
